Facilitating analysis of attribution models
US-2022222594-A1 · Jul 14, 2022 · US
US12579552B1 · US · B1
| Field | Value |
|---|---|
| Publication number | US-12579552-B1 |
| Application number | US-202217902654-A |
| Country | US |
| Kind code | B1 |
| Filing date | Sep 2, 2022 |
| Priority date | Sep 2, 2022 |
| Publication date | Mar 17, 2026 |
| Grant date | Mar 17, 2026 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A system monitors impression data from a plurality of media channels including attributes of content presented on a respective media channel. The system inputs the impressions data and conversion data into a machine learning predictive model. The machine learning predictive model is trained by determining an impact of historical impression data on historical conversion data for each media channel. A machine learning predictive model incorporates an impressions/conversions predictive model that generates coefficients to measure attribution of different channel/campaign combinations to predicted conversions. The machine learning predictive model also incorporates an optimization model to effectively allocate marketing budget among various channels and campaigns in order to realize incremental conversions. The optimization model utilizes a constrained optimization framework based upon user-inputted budgets and budget constraints. Disclosed mixed media marketing predictive modeling provides a better understanding of budget allocation strategy for mixed media marketing factors.
Opening claim text (preview).
What is claimed is: 1 . A computer-implemented method for improving multi-media content allocation comprising: monitoring, by a computer, impression data input from a plurality of electronic communication channels into a machine learning predictive model, the impression data comprising one or more combinations of a plurality of attributes of impression content presented via one or more impression generators for each electronic communication channel of the plurality of electronic communication channels; inputting, by the computer, conversion data comprising one or more attributes of one or more transactions corresponding to the impression content presented via the plurality of electronic communication channels and impression data into the machine learning predictive model, wherein the machine learning predictive model is trained by: determining, based on a transformation model, an impact one or more time-based carry-over effects of one or more combinations of historical impression data on historical conversion data for each electronic communication channel of the plurality of electronic communication channels; and reducing overfitting of the machine learning predictive model by: converting the impression data to one or more parameter features corresponding to one or more attributes of the impression content; and reducing, based on a corresponding significance of each of the one or more parameter features determined using a variance-covariance model corresponding to the one or more parameter features, a number of the one or more parameter features; establishing, baseline values for one or more timing parameters corresponding to respective electronic communication channels, the timing parameters controlling a significance of impression data over time on predicted conversion tendencies; executing, by the computer, the machine learning predictive model to predict model parameters for each electronic communication channel of the plurality of electronic communication channels, wherein the model parameters represent a conversion tendency for each electronic communication channel of the plurality of electronic communication channels; updating, by the computer, the machine learning predictive model by adjusting one or more timing parameters in response to differences between the predicted conversion tendencies and actual conversions observed for corresponding recent impression content to refine weighting of prior impressions and improve accuracy of subsequent executions for allocating content selection across each electronic communication channel; and allocating, by the computer, an adjusted electronic communication channel content to each electronic communication channel of the plurality of electronic communication channels based on an optimization model that models one or more combinations of the model parameters according to an objective function and one or more optimization constraints. 2 . The method of claim 1 , wherein each electronic communication channel of the plurality of electronic communication channels corresponds to a respective campaign. 3 . The method of claim 1 , further comprising inputting, by the computer, a plurality of factors into the machine learning predictive model, wherein the plurality of factors comprise at least one of: seasonality, customer value, agent score, awareness, consideration, affinity, consumer confidence index (CCI), consumer price index (CPI), gasoline price, or unemployment rate. 4 . The method of claim 1 , wherein modeling one or more combinations of the model parameters according to an objective function and one or more optimization constraints generates a maximum total predicted conversions. 5 . The method of claim 4 , wherein the one or more optimization constraints comprise a marketing expenditure budget that serves as equality constraint in Legrangian analysis. 6 . The method of claim 4 , wherein the one or more optimization constraints comprise one or both of upper bounds for total marketing expenditures associated with respective electronic communication channels, and lower bounds for the total marketing expenditures associated with the respective electronic communication channels. 7 . The method of claim 4 , further comprising determining an optimal mix of impressions to achieve the maximum total predicted conversions based upon the model parameters for each electronic communication channel of the plurality of electronic communication channels. 8 . The method of claim 7 , further comprising generating the maximum total predicted conversions during a given time period and determining the optimal mix of impressions to achieve the maximum total predicted conversions during the given time period. 9 . The method of claim 8 , further comprising converting the optimal mix of impressions to optimal expenditures associated with the optimal mix of impressions. 10 . A system for improving multi-media content allocation comprising: an analytical engine server comprising: a mixed marketing model configured for generating conversion parameters for a plurality of marketing channel-campaign combinations by inputting impression parameters for a plurality of impression channel-campaign combinations into a machine learning predictive model, wherein each impression parameter represents a respective impression tendency attributed to a combination of a respective impression channel and a respective marketing campaign, wherein each conversion parameter represents a respective conversion tendency attributed to a combination of a respective marketing channel and a respective marketing campaign, wherein the machine learning predictive model is continually trained by: inputting one or more combinations of training data representing historical impressions impression data and historical conversions conversion data of an enterprise; determining, based on a transformation model, one or more time-based carry-over effects of the historical impression data on historical conversion data for each marketing channel-campaign combination of the plurality of marketing channel-campaign combinations; and reducing overfitting of the machine learning predictive model by: converting the impression data to one or more parameter features corresponding to one or more attributes of the impression content; and reducing, based on a corresponding significance of each of the one or more parameter features determined using a variance-covariance model corresponding to the one or more parameter features, a number of the one or more parameter features; establishing, baseline values for one or more timing parameters corresponding to respective electronic communication channels, the timing parameters controlling a significance of impression data over time on predicted conversion tendencies; a marketing mix optimization model configured for calculating maximum total predicted conversions by inputting the conversion parameters for the plurality of marketing channel-campaign combinations received from the mixed marketing model, wherein the marketing mix optimization model applies an objective function the plurality of marketing channel-campaign combinations subject to one or more optimization constraints based on marketing expenditure; and further configured for determining an optimal mix of impressions to achieve the maximum total predicted conversions; wherein the machine learning predictive model is updated by adjusting one or more timing parameters in response to differences between the predicted conversion tendencies and actual conversions observed for corresponding recent impression content to refine weighting of prior impressions and improve accuracy of subsequent executions for allocating
Knowledge engineering; Knowledge acquisition · CPC title
Market predictions or forecasting for commercial activities ·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.